COMMONWEALTH v. HUNT


350 S.W.2d 700 (1961)

COMMONWEALTH of Kentucky DEPARTMENT OF HIGHWAYS, Appellant, v. Ethel HUNT, Widow, et al., Appellees.

Court of Appeals of Kentucky.

Rehearing Denied December 1, 1961.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

John B. Breckinridge, Atty. Gen., H. D. Reed, Jr., Asst. Atty. Gen., C. E. Skidmore, Legal Section, Dept. of Highways, Frankfort, for appellant.

King, Deep & Branaman, Dorsey & Sullivan, Odie Duncan, Henderson, for appellees.


CLAY, Commissioner.

This is an appeal by the Commonwealth in a condemnation case from an order of the circuit court dismissing its appeal from a county court judgment which confirmed a Commissioners' award of $44,000. In all pertinent respects the procedural questions involved are identical with those in the case of Commonwealth of Kentucky v. Utley, Ky., 350 S.W.2d 698.
